Sodium benzenesulfinate (50 g, 304.6 mmol) was dissolved in water (200 ml). A dioxane solution (200 ml) of chloroacetone (29.6 g, 319.9 mmol) was added and the solution was stirred and heated to 50° C. for 22 hours then cooled to approximately 25° C. The solution was extracted with methylene chloride (2X, 250 ml), the methylene chloride layers were combined and washed with saturated aqueous sodium bicarbonate solution (1X, 250 ml) and water (1X, 250 ml) then the aqueous wash solutions were combined and extracted with methylene chloride (2X, 100 ml). All of the methylene chloride layers were combined and washed with saturated aqueous sodium chloride solution (1X, 150 ml), dried over sodium sulfate, filtered and concentrated in vacuo to a solid. The solid was dissolved in diethyl ether (800 ml) with gentle heating and then the solution was stirred and allowed to cool to room temperature. The solution was slowly cooled to 0° C. with stirring, causing the product to crystallize. The resulting crystals were collected by filtration, washed with cold diethyl ether, and dried in vacuo at 35° C. for 4 hours to yield 36.43 g of (phenylsulfonyl)acetone. The filtrate was concentrated to approximately one-eighth of its volume in vacuo and was gradually cooled below room temperature to induce crystallization, then stirred overnight at room temperature. The resulting crystals were collected by filtration, washed with cold diethyl ether, and dried in vacuo at 35° C. for 8 hours to yield an additional 14 g of the (phenylsulfonyl)acetone: n.m.r. (90 MHz, CDCl3): δ 2.39 (s, 3), 4.17 (s, 2), 7.55-7.95 (m, 5); m.p. 56°-58° C.
